对字符串直接比大小,有时会出现错误情况,比如: ...
场景: 在一个遍历的的程序中,有一步需要调用函数,调用的方式是根据输入参数,从 个可供被调用的函数中,选择其中一个。所以写了一个dict : function a name , : function b name , : function c name 。这时需要将函数转化成可执行的代码。 方案: 使用内置函数 exec 使用内置函数 eval 结果: 使用exec时没有达到目的,eval可以实现 ...
2018-09-29 14:51 0 677 推荐指数:
对字符串直接比大小,有时会出现错误情况,比如: ...
除了其他博客普遍使用的方法: ...
题目要求:写一个程序, 把字符串转化为数字, 例如 '123' 转化为 123 '0.254' 转化为 0.254 不允许使用int函数 float函数 eval函数,不允许导入任何模块 import sys chars = { '0': 0, '1': 1, '2': 2, '3': 3, '4': 4, '5': 5, '6': 6, '7': 7, '8': 8, '9': ...
1.1 python字符串定义 #!/usr/bin/python # -*- coding: utf8 -*- # 定义 ...
在json模块有2个方法, loads():将json数据转化成dict数据 dumps():将dict数据转化成json数据 load():读取json文件数据,转成dict数据 dump():将dict数据转化成json数据后写入json文件 1、把请求体的json串 ...
有一个需求,需要用python把json字符串转化为字典 inp_str = " {'k1':123, 'k2': '345',’k3’,’ares’} " 死活出不来结果,还报错,没搞明白。 最后 ...
利用map和reduce编写一个str2float函数,把字符串'123.456'转换成浮点数123.456。 思路:计算小数位数--->将字符串中的小数点去掉--->字符串转换为整数--->整数转换为浮点数 知识点: 1、将字符串中的小数点去掉可以用切片 ...